Factors Influencing LeBron's 2K Rating

Several key factors come into play when determining LeBron James's 2K rating. First and foremost is his performance in the previous NBA season. This includes his scoring average, rebounding numbers, assists, defensive stats, and overall impact on his team's success. Game developers meticulously analyze these statistics to gauge his effectiveness on the court. Another crucial factor is his age and physical condition. As players age, their physical abilities naturally decline, which can affect their performance and, consequently, their 2K rating. Developers must assess whether LeBron is maintaining his peak form or showing signs of slowing down. The overall landscape of the NBA also plays a significant role. If other players have significantly improved or new stars have emerged, it can influence LeBron's ranking relative to his peers. 2K ratings are often adjusted to reflect the current hierarchy of talent in the league. His consistency and durability are also important considerations. If LeBron has a season plagued by injuries or inconsistent play, it can negatively impact his rating. Conversely, a season of consistent excellence and leadership can boost his score. Finally, the developers consider his intangible qualities, such as leadership, basketball IQ, and clutch performance. These are harder to quantify but are essential to capturing the full essence of LeBron's game. Predicting LeBron's 2K24 Rating

Predicting LeBron James's 2K24 rating requires a careful analysis of his performance in the 2022-2023 NBA season. Despite his age, LeBron continued to showcase his exceptional skills, averaging impressive numbers in scoring, rebounding, and assists. However, injuries and the Lakers' overall performance could influence his rating. Given his sustained excellence, it's likely that his rating will remain among the highest in the game, possibly in the range of 96-98. This would reflect his continued status as one of the league's top players, even as he enters the later stages of his career. While his athleticism may not be quite what it once was, his basketball IQ, leadership, and all-around skill set remain elite. Therefore, the developers will likely balance his physical attributes with his mental and intangible qualities to arrive at a fair and accurate rating. Impact of LeBron's Rating on the Game

LeBron James's 2K rating has a significant impact on the gameplay experience and overall balance of the game. A high rating makes him a dominant force on the virtual court, capable of scoring, rebounding, passing, and defending at an elite level. This can influence players' strategies and team selections, as many will prioritize having LeBron on their roster. His presence also raises the stakes in online matchups, as players eagerly anticipate facing off against one of the game's most powerful avatars. The developers must carefully balance his attributes to ensure that he is not overpowered, while still accurately reflecting his real-world abilities. If he is too dominant, it can make the game feel unrealistic or unfair. Conversely, if he is underpowered, it can diminish the experience of playing with one of the greatest basketball players of all time. LeBron's rating also affects the game's overall meta, influencing which teams and playstyles are most effective. His presence can encourage players to adopt strategies that revolve around his strengths, such as pick-and-roll offense or fast-break transitions. Furthermore, his rating can impact the value of virtual currency and player cards in the game's various modes. A high-rated LeBron card is often highly sought after, driving up its price in the virtual marketplace.
